description Notions of T- and R-connectivity of seismic events have been introduced and on their base formalized criterion of earthquakes neighborhood has been proposed. Methodic problems of discrimination of interconnected events with the help of graphs theory have been considered. A set of test calculations for the earthquakes of the central part of the Crimean-Black Sea region have been conducted. It has been demonstrated that in the matrix of orgraph contiguity all the significant activation periods al of seismic activity occurred in 1984, 1990, 1998 and 2009 are reflected. For the Crimean earthquakes of 1984 and 1998 the chains of interconnected events have been distinguished about two years long, which confirm the migration of low rank events to the site of future strong one.
